In Peoria-Heights, IL, lenders calculate the expenses for building a 2,000 square foot home, with costs estimated from $208,876 for basic construction to $382,299 for more luxurious finishes. Interest rates and loan conditions vary, influenced by the borrower's financial profile, including the Loan-to-Value (LTV) ratio, After-Repair Value (ARV), and the choice of lender.   • In December of 1914, W.R. Simpson, Byron Colburn, and S. E. Naffziger founded Goodfield State Bank in Mr. Naffziger’s country store. Patrons conducted banking business in one corner of the store until a building was completed in 1915.

    Goodfield State Bank was officially incorporated in the State of Illinois in December of 1920

  • The Atlanta National Bank is a branch office of The Atlanta National Bank. They’re located in 105 SW Church St in Atlanta, Illinois. Their bank charter class is N, which means they’re a commercial bank, national (federal) charter and Fed member, supervised by the Office of the Comptroller of the Currency (OCC).
